Wenger Admits Arsenal Will Spend In The January Transfer Window
It has been reported that Arsenal boss Arsene Wenger has predicted plenty of activity in the transfer window as the current Premier League table toppers look to strengthen their challenge for the title. Wenger suggested they were keen to spend, especially considering long-term injuries to Danny Welbeck, Jack Wilshere and Francis Coquelin. 'I'll be busy, that's for sure,' the Frenchman said about his January activities. 'I'm already busy and I said already one month ago we are a bit short to deal with all the competitions we face, especially in midfield. We will be busy, yes.'
